Level Extreme platform
Subscription
Corporate profile
Products & Services
Support
Legal
Français
Count(*)
Message
General information
Forum:
Visual FoxPro
Category:
Coding, syntax & commands
Title:
Miscellaneous
Thread ID:
00499134
Message ID:
00499153
Views:
18
>I have some code that looks like this:
>
>SELECT bank ,settdate, SUM(amount) AS amount, COUNT(*) AS Items ;
>FROM ncredit2 ;
>GROUP BY bank ;
>INTO TABLE nCredit_report
>
>For some reason SUM(amount) comes out to the right number but COUNT(*) give me the wrong number.
>
>There should be 24 records in the table. Count gives me only 22. Is it because two of the records amount field is equal to zero (0.00)?
>
>Thanks in advance for your help.
>
>Randall

OK, third try :) [i keep getting a validation message...]

Sounds like there's 2 deleted records. RECCOUNT() and the status bar message that shows the record count include deleted records, but if SET DELETED is ON (which it probably is), then COUNT(*) does not include deleted records.
Insanity: Doing the same thing over and over and expecting different results.
Previous
Next
Reply
Map
View

Click here to load this message in the networking platform